Surface Compatibility Matters to Me

Before I buy, I always make sure the coating works with my deck material. Some coatings perform better on wood, concrete, or plywood than others. I check the product details carefully so I do not end up with something that is hard to apply or not suitable for my surface.

Ease of Application Is Important

I prefer a deck coating that is straightforward to apply. If I can use a roller, brush, or sprayer without needing complicated tools, that saves me time and effort. I also pay attention to whether the product needs primers, multiple coats, or special prep work, because that affects how much work I need to do.

Weather Resistance Is a Top Priority

Since my deck is exposed to the elements, I want a coating that can stand up to heat, UV rays, rain, and changing temperatures. I look for a product that advertises strong weather resistance so I know it will last longer and keep my deck protected through the seasons.

Drying Time and Cure Time

I always check how long the coating takes to dry and fully cure. If I need to use my deck soon, I want a product with a reasonable turnaround time. I also make sure I plan ahead, because some coatings may feel dry faster than they are fully ready for heavy use.

Coverage and Value for Money

When I compare options, I look at how much area one container covers. A product may seem affordable at first, but if it covers less square footage, it may cost me more in the end. I try to balance price, coverage, and performance so I get the best value for my money.
